BERLIN (AFP) - Bundesliga title contenders Werder Bremen will strengthen their squad for next season with Austrian defender Sebastian Proedl who will join the north German club in the summer on a four-year contract.

The 20-year-old centre back joins Bremen from Austrian league leaders Graz.

"I decided early on to join Werder, because I like the atmosphere in the side and the work ethic," said Proedl.

Proedl made his debut for Austria while still a teenager and has won seven senior caps for his country.

He was part of the Austrian team which caused an upset by reaching the semi-finals of the Under-20 World Cup in Canada last year.
